Conclusion Meanings:

'Exonerated': or 'Within NYPD Guidelines' - the alleged conduct occurred but did not violate the NYPD's own rules, which often give officers significant discretion.
'Substantiated': The alleged conduct occurred and it violated the rules. The NYPD has discretion over what, if any, discipline is imposed.
'Unfounded': Evidence suggests that the event or alleged conduct did not occur.
'Unsubstantiated': or 'Unable to Determine' - CCRB has fully investigated but could not affirmatively conclude both that the conduct occurred and that it broke the rules.
'Within NYPD Guidelines': The alleged conduct occurred but did not violate the NYPD's own rules, which often give officers significant discretion.

Lawsuits

Blades, Lakesha vs City of New York, et al.
Case # 810880/2022E, Supreme Court - Bronx, August 2, 2022
Complaint
Description: On December 15, 2020, while Plaintiff was taking out the trash, she was aggressed and hit by her tenant. She called 911 and lawfully waited in front of the building in Bronx when the police arrived. Plaintiff's injuries were treated by the Emergency Medical Technicians and while she went back to her apartment to get a needed gauze, Plaintiff was subject to an unlawful arrest, detention, assault, battery and excessive use of force by the Defendants. Richard Kissane and Danilo McLeish became physically aggressive and grabbed Plaintiff’s wrists, slammed her into the wall, and dragged her into the hallway. Jason Garcia, then slammed her on the floor, used a chokehold against her and put a taser to her face. Plaint...
